版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/lj6020382/article/details/82817720
一、问题描述
在限定背包重量的情况下,选择最优价值的物品放入背包,使总体价值最大。
二、解题思路
1.确定状态转换方程。
2.找出所选物品。
三、注意事项
1.优化空间复杂度:采用一维数组代替二维数组。但是存在无法回找装入物品的弊端。
四、代码实现
见我的github:backpack